Premier Gambling Operators
The realm of major gambling operators is led by a select group of players that have transformed the market through advancement and expansion. Las Vegas Sands is one of the top brands, known for its opulent establishments such as The Venetian and The Palazzo in Las Vegas, along with its flagship destination in Macau. Their focus on integrated developments has established a benchmark in the industry, attracting millions of visitors each year and generating significant revenue from both gaming and non-gaming activities.
MGM Resorts is another key operator, with a collection that includes prestigious venues like the Bellagio and MGM Grand Hotel. The firm’s approach has focused around crafting immersive experiences for guests, merging entertainment, dining, and gambling in one space. As they grow globally, their emphasis on sustainability and community involvement has also begun to define their brand in the challenging gambling sector.
Wynn Resorts has secured itself as a symbol of elegance and luxury gaming.
